Grand Jury Investigates Celina Cass DeathJan. 25, 2012
Six months after an 11-year-old New Hampshire girl disappeared from her home during the middle of the night, no suspects have been named in her abduction or death. However, a grand jury has heard testimony from members of Celina Cass' family as the lead prosecutor claims the investigation remains active.

Police: Celina Cass Was MurderedSept. 22, 2011
An 11-year-old New Hampshire girl, whose body was found in the Connecticut River a week after she disappeared, was murdered according to police investigators. The death of Celina Cass of West Stewartstown was not an accident, authorities said.
No Answers in Celina Cass Case
Aug. 17, 2011
More than two weeks after a missing 11-year-old New Hampshire girl's body was found in a river near her home, police apparently still have more questions than answers. No arrests have been made yet in the death of fifth grader Celina Cass, leaving residents in West Stewartstown wondering if a killer is still loose.
Body of Celina Cass Found
Aug. 1, 2011
Authorities have confirmed that a female body recovered from the Connecticut River near the Canaan Hydro-Dam is that of an 11-year-old New Hampshire girl missing since July 25. The body of Celina Cass was found by a dive team in the river that divides New Hampshire and Vermont.
Frantic Search for Missing NH Girl
June 25, 2011
More than 100 law enforcement officers have joined the frantic search for a missing 11-year-old New Hampshire girl who was last seen using her computer in her bedroom Monday evening. Celina Cass is described as a shy 5th grader who would never run away or leave with a stranger.
